Home
last modified time | relevance | path

Searched refs:mFrameSize (Results 1 – 3 of 3) sorted by relevance

/device/generic/goldfish/hals/audio/
Ddevice_port_sink.cpp54 , mFrameSize(util::countChannels(cfg.base.channelMask) * sizeof(int16_t)) in TinyalsaSink()
58 , mRingBuffer(mFrameSize * cfg.frameCount * 3) in TinyalsaSink()
125 return mRingBuffer.capacity() / mFrameSize - pendingFrames; in calcAvailableFramesNowLocked()
138 const size_t waitFrames = calcWaitFramesNowLocked(bytesToWrite / mFrameSize); in write()
155 std::min(produceChunk.size, bytesToWrite) / mFrameSize; in write()
156 const size_t szBytes = szFrames * mFrameSize; in write()
170 size_t(1000000 * bytesToWrite / mFrameSize / mSampleRateHz)); in write()
174 framesLost += bytesLost / mFrameSize; in write()
179 std::min(produceChunk.size, bytesToWrite) / mFrameSize; in write()
180 const size_t szBytes = szFrames * mFrameSize; in write()
[all …]
Ddevice_port_source.cpp57 , mFrameSize(util::countChannels(cfg.base.channelMask) * sizeof(int16_t)) in TinyalsaSource()
60 , mRingBuffer(mFrameSize * cfg.frameCount * 3) in TinyalsaSource()
118 const size_t waitFrames = getWaitFramesNowLocked(bytesToRead / mFrameSize); in read()
144 mSentFrames += writeBufSzBytes / mFrameSize; in read()
149 size_t(1000000 * bytesToRead / mFrameSize / mSampleRateHz)); in read()
155 std::min(bytesToRead, sizeof(zeroes)) / mFrameSize; in read()
156 const size_t nZeroBytes = nZeroFrames * mFrameSize; in read()
171 std::vector<uint8_t> readBuf(mReadSizeFrames * mFrameSize); in producerThread()
175 mFramesLost += bytesLost / mFrameSize; in producerThread()
194 const int n = talsa::pcmRead(mPcm.get(), dst, sz, mFrameSize); in doRead()
[all …]
Dstream_out.cpp144 mFrameSize = mStream->getFrameSize(); in threadLoop()
219 const size_t written = reader.totalRead / mFrameSize; in doWrite()
267 size_t mFrameSize = 1; // updated when the sink is created. member in android::hardware::audio::CPP_VERSION::implementation::__anon9e13638b0111::WriteThread